在过去的几年中,Microsoft一直在努力为Windows带来改进。但是,不能否认操作系统仍然容易出错。这些问题中的一些阻止用户执行其典型的计算任务。如果在完成工作时遇到这些错误代码之一,可能会令人沮丧。
在以前的文章中,我们分享了有关如何摆脱某些错误代码的提示。但是,在这篇文章中,我们将教您如何解决Windows 10上的错误0x800f081f。我们还将分享一些可能导致此问题发生的原因。一旦知道了问题的根本原因,就可以防止它再次发生。
引起的错误代码0x800f081f是什么?
在大多数情况下,由于Microsoft .NET Framework 3.5不兼容,出现错误代码0x800f081f。用户报告说,通过部署映像服务和管理(DISM)工具,安装向导或Windows PowerShell命令启用.NET Framework后,已发生此问题。
错误代码0x800f081f通常出现在Windows 10,Windows 8.1,Windows 8,Windows Server版本1709,Windows Server 2016,Windows Server 2012 R2和Windows Server 2012上。值得注意的是,Microsoft .NET Framework 3.5是“对我们提到的操作系统的需求。因此,默认情况下未启用该功能。
除了错误代码0x800F081F,由于相同的潜在问题,还会显示其他四个代码。这些错误代码是0x800F0906、0x800F0907和0x800F0922。因此,如果您碰巧遇到这些错误代码之一,则可以使用下面列出的解决方案来解决此问题。我们不仅在教您如何解决Windows 10上的错误0x800f081f,而且还在帮助您修复其他三个错误代码!
解决方案1:配置您的组策略
修复错误代码800f081f的方法之一是配置组策略。毕竟,与此有关的某些问题可能会影响操作系统激活安装的能力。值得注意的是,Windows 10的企业版,专业版和教育版均提供了组策略编辑器。因此,如果您使用的操作系统版本不同,则将无法看到该功能。也就是说,您仍然可以按照下一个解决方案中的说明摆脱错误代码。
首先,请按照下列步骤操作:
- 通过按键盘上的Windows键+ R启动运行对话框。
- 现在,在框中键入“ gpedit.msc”(不带引号),然后单击“确定”。这样做可以让您打开组策略编辑器。
- 组策略编辑器启动后,转到左侧窗格菜单并导航至以下路径:
计算机配置->管理模板->系统
- 转到右侧面板,然后向下滚动,直到找到“为可选组件安装和组件修复指定设置”条目。
- 双击该条目,然后转到左上角以选中“启用”旁边的框。
- 单击确定。
解决方案2:使用DISM命令启用.NET Framework
此解决方案最适用于错误代码0x800F0922,但它也可以修复错误0x800F081F。在这种方法中,您需要运行DISM命令才能激活.NET Framework。只要您按照发球台上的说明进行操作,过程就不会很复杂。
在继续执行此步骤之前,您需要获取Windows 10的ISO映像。请记住,要获取的版本必须与当前操作系统匹配。您可以使用媒体创建工具制作ISO映像。您可以从Microsoft的网站下载此工具。
下载完媒体创建工具后,运行它,然后单击“为另一台PC创建安装媒体”选项。将打开一个新屏幕,您需要选择语言和系统架构。选择ISO文件开始创建过程。将ISO文件保存在USB闪存驱动器上或将其刻录到DVD上。完成此操作后,您可以按照以下步骤开始解决错误代码:
- 插入DVD或将带有ISO文件的USB闪存驱动器插入计算机。
- 双击ISO文件以自动安装它。您也可以通过右键单击文件并从选项中选择“挂载”来挂载文件。看一下窗口的左侧面板。如果过程成功,您应该可以在虚拟驱动器中看到ISO。记下驱动器号。如果要卸载映像,请在“这台PC”中右键单击虚拟驱动器,然后从上下文菜单中选择“弹出”。
- 挂载图像后,单击任务栏上的“搜索”图标。
- 在搜索框中输入“ cmd”(不带引号)。
- 在结果中右键单击“命令提示符”,然后选择“以管理员身份运行”。
- 一旦命令提示符启动,粘贴以下文本:
Dism / online /启用功能/功能名称:NetFx3 /全部/来源:[驱动器]:\ sources \ sxs / LimitAccess
注意:切记用在步骤2中记下的字母替换[Drive]。
- 按Enter键运行命令。
重新安装Microsoft .NET Framework 3.5
按照我们共享的说明进行操作之后,您现在就可以继续安装.NET Framework 3.5,以查看错误代码0x800F081F是否消失了。为此,请按照以下说明进行操作:
- 转到任务栏,然后右键单击Windows图标。
- 从选项中选择设置。
- 在“设置”应用中,单击“应用”,然后选择“应用和功能”。
- 向下滚动,直到找到“相关设置”部分。单击其下面的程序和功能。
- 转到左侧窗格菜单,然后单击“打开或关闭Windows功能”链接。
- 查找“ .NET Framework 3.5(包括.NET 2.0和3.0)”条目,然后选择它旁边的框。
- 单击“确定”开始安装过程。
如果您能够毫无问题地安装Microsoft .NET Framework 3.5,则意味着您已经消除了错误代码0x800F081F。此功能与许多问题有关。使用Windows 10技术预览版的一些人报告说该文件丢失了,从而在他们的系统中引起了很多问题。
这是我们在一篇博客文章中解决的一个合理问题。但是,您需要警惕一些恶意消息,这些消息告诉您.Net Framework文件由于有害病毒而丢失。在大多数情况下,这是由广告软件引起的,它可能会诱使您致电假冒的联系中心。如果您不小心,可能最终会将您的信用卡详细信息和其他敏感信息提供给欺诈者。
因此,我们建议您使用Auslogics Anti-Malware之类的功能强大的安全工具来保护您的计算机。这个可靠的软件程序将清理您的系统,并清除广告软件和其他可疑物品。它甚至具有友好的界面,使您可以轻松设置和运行扫描。
您希望我们接下来解决哪个错误代码?
在下面的评论部分提出您的问题!